Punjab CM Mann dedicates eight libraries to people in Barnala

BARNALA: Punjab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ann on Saturday dedicated eight public libraries, constructed at a cost of Rs 2.80 crore, to people here. Speaking at the event, the chief minister said that eight libraries in the assembly constituencies of Bhadaur and Mehal Kalan have been dedicated to people. Mann said that Rs 2.80 crore has been spent on these eight libraries constructed at Shehna, Dhaula, Talwandi, Majhuke, Kutba, Deewana, Wajidke Kalan and Thulliwal villages, adding each library has been built at a cost of Rs 35 lakh. Equipped with modern infrastructure, these libraries have facilities like computers, internet access, quality literature and books to help prepare for competitive exams, he added. The chief minister said these libraries have kindled a new hope among students to realize their dreams. Students from remote villages can now access knowledge from around the world through books while staying in their own villages, he added.
